Business owners without design backgrounds often underestimate how significantly genuine visual design quality affects trust, perceived credibility, and ultimately conversion β treating it as a lower priority than it genuinely deserves.
Why Visual Design Functions as an Immediate Trust Signal
Visitors form genuine, often subconscious judgments about credibility within seconds of encountering your visual presentation β polished, professional design signals competence and legitimacy before a visitor has read any actual content.
The Genuine Cost of Amateur or Inconsistent Design
Visual design that reads as amateur or inconsistent can undermine trust even when your actual product or service quality is genuinely excellent β the mismatch between visual presentation and genuine substance creates confusion and hesitation that well-executed design would avoid.
How Professional Design Supports Genuine Brand Differentiation
Distinctive, well-executed visual design helps differentiate your business from competitors relying on generic, templated presentation β genuine visual distinctiveness supports the broader differentiation your marketing strategy depends on.
Balancing Genuine Investment Against Realistic Budget
Professional design doesn't require unlimited budget β understanding where visual investment genuinely matters most (core brand elements, primary conversion pages) allows more deliberate prioritization than either neglecting design entirely or over-investing uniformly everywhere.
Why Consistency Matters as Much as Individual Quality
Even genuinely high-quality individual design elements can undermine trust if they're visually inconsistent with each other β a coherent, consistent visual system, even if simpler than elaborate individual pieces, often serves better than inconsistent elements of varying quality and style.
Understanding the Genuine Difference Between Decoration and Functional Design
Effective design isn't purely about aesthetic appeal β genuinely functional design that supports clarity, usability, and conversion provides more concrete business value than purely decorative visual elements that don't serve a genuine functional purpose.
Recognizing When DIY Design Genuinely Falls Short
While some business owners can produce genuinely adequate design themselves, honestly recognizing when your own design skills fall meaningfully short of what your business genuinely needs β and investing in professional support accordingly β protects against the real costs of persistently amateur presentation.
Measuring the Genuine Return on Design Investment
Where possible, testing the actual conversion and trust impact of design improvements provides concrete evidence of genuine return, helping justify continued design investment based on real business results rather than purely subjective aesthetic preference.
